    Who is Dr. Nitti, Family Medicine Specialist in Berkeley Heights, NJ?

    Dr. Michele Nitti, DO is a Family Medicine Specialist, who primarily practices in Berkeley Heights, NJ with 2 additional practice locations. She has been practicing for over 31 years and is board certified by the American Board of Family Medicine. Dr. Nitti graduated from Rutgers and completed her residency at Mountainside Hosp, Family Medicine. Dr. Nitti is fluent in English and Spanish, and is currently seeing new patients.     What is Dr. Michele Nitti's specialty?

    Dr. Nitti is a Family Medicine Specialist near Berkeley Heights, NJ. Family Medicine is a medical specialty focused on comprehensive healthcare for individuals and families. It is a broad field that integrates biological, clinical, and behavioral sciences.
